CH2M to highlight sustainability expertise at American Society of Civil Engineers International Conference on Sustainable Infrastructure

CH2M experts will be sharing best practices and sustainable solutions to resource management, engineering design and program management, as they participate in presentations, panels and sessions during the American Society of Civil Engineers (ASCE) International Conference on Sustainable Infrastructure (ICSI). The conference will be held October 26-28, 2017, in Brooklyn, New York.
By championing sustainability-inspired principles, knowledge, technologies, tools and methods that lead to better long-term solutions that respond to critical global issues, business realities and stakeholder values, our experts are helping infrastructure leaders think systemically and holistically to identify and address challenges and to help make the business case for sustainability. As a charter member of the Institute for Sustainable Infrastructure (ISI), CH2M is regarded as a proven source of thought leadership in sustainable infrastructure planning and design.
ASCE ICSI will bring together experts and leaders in sustainable infrastructure from around the world to exchange ideas about trends and policies.
